  2. So define prosper? Someone earlier posted that baskeball sells out Conseco. Attendance has died for baskeball since the class system. They moved the finals to the hoosier dome and sold out 42,000 uner a one class system!! Now you are lucky to get 8,000 to 9,000 per session. I have good friend who is a baskeball coach and he said " he likes the fact that his small school has a better chance to advance but it has killed the attendance through the tourney. It's just not the same" :'(
  3. So Howe would have been a 4 timer in a class system. He wouldn't have wrestled Humphrey his freshman year. Do you think he would have gotten a better schollarship? Cody Phillips would be a 3 timer right now. Do you think that would make him a better wrestler? ??? All a class system would do is water down the tourney. You would have some wrestlers get al the way to semi-state and maybe only wrestle 2 or 3 actual the matches do to forfeits. It comes down to this its man on man either you make the grade or you don't! Next door in Ohio do you really think it mattered what class David Taylor wrestled in? Me either ;D
